I am doing some testing on pg_basebackup and pg_combinebackup patches. I have also tried to create tap test for pg_combinebackup by taking reference from pg_basebackup tap cases.
Attaching first draft test patch.
I have done some testing with compression options, both -z and -Z level is working with incremental backup.
A minor comment : It is mentioned in pg_combinebackup help that maximum 10 incremental backup can be given with -i option, but I found maximum 9 incremental backup directories can be given at a time.

Due to the inherent nature of pg_basebackup, the incremental backup also
allows taking backup in tar and compressed format. But, pg_combinebackup
does not understand how to restore this. I think we should either make
pg_combinebackup support restoration of tar incremental backup or restrict
taking the incremental backup in tar format until pg_combinebackup
supports the restoration by making option '--lsn' and '-Ft' exclusive.
It is arguable that one can take the incremental backup in tar format, extract
that manually and then give the resultant directory as input to the
pg_combinebackup, but I think that kills the purpose of having
pg_combinebackup utility.
